Skip to main content

AccessTr.neT


Hastane Randevu Çakışması

erdalyılmaz90
erdalyılmaz90
12
5505

Hastane Randevu Çakışması

Çözüldü #1
Değerli AccessTr.net üyeleri merhaba,

Belki çok basit ama çözümünü bulamadığım bir konu.

Proje ödevim hastane kayıt ve randevu sistemini yaptım.Ancak okulda hocamın istediği 4 isteği yapamadım.

1) Ana menüdeki Tarih sorgulamada İlk tarih (bizim sectiğimiz tarih) ve Son tarih (bizim sectiğimiz tarih) arasındaki sorgulamayı yapamadım.

2)Hasta randevu alırken o günde ve saate doktor dolusa doktor doludur diye hata verdirdim.Randevu alamıyor ama hata gösterirken kaydet butonunda göstermesi lazım iken kapat butonuna basınca gösteriyor.Bu hatayı kaydet butonunda göstermek istiyorum.Kaydet butonunda başka hata göstermekdedir.

3)Hasta randevu alırken aynı günde aynı saate randevusu varken tekrardan yine aynı gün ve saate baska doktorada randevuyu alabiliyor.Bunuda kaydet butonuna basarken engellemek hata verdirmek istiyorum.

4)Son olarakda doktor eğer o gün o saate baska randevusu varsa hastaya o doktora randevu saatinde randevu vermemesini sağladım.Fakat hata gösterirken kaydet butonunda göstermesi lazım iken kapat butonuna basınca gösteriyor.Bu hatayı kaydet butonunda göstermek istiyorum.Kaydet butonunda başka hata göstermekdedir.

Yardımcı olabilirseniz memnun olurum.Şimdiden çok teşekkür ederim...

Hastane Takip.zip
.zip Hastane Takip.zip (Dosya Boyutu: 2,05 MB | İndirme Sayısı: 37)
Son Düzenleme: 26/07/2012, 06:43, Düzenleyen: erdalyılmaz90.
Cevapla
Çözüldü #2
Şimdiden her şey için çok teşekkür ederim.Hayırlı ramazanlar...
Son Düzenleme: 26/07/2012, 06:48, Düzenleyen: erdalyılmaz90.
Cevapla
Çözüldü #3
(26/07/2012, 05:32)erdalyılmaz90 yazdı: 1) Ana menüdeki Tarih sorgulamada İlk tarih (bizim sectiğimiz tarih) ve Son tarih (bizim sectiğimiz tarih) arasındaki sorgulamayı yapamadım.

İlk olarak 1. sorunzdan başladım iş arasında fırsat buldukça diğer sorulara da bakmay çalışırım.

TARİH formunuzun tarih_sorgula Liste kutusunun satır kaynağını aşağıdaki gibi oluşturun.
SELECT RANDEVU.RANDEVU_SIRASI, RANDEVU.HASTA_AD_SOYAD, RANDEVU.RANDEVU_TARIHI, RANDEVU.DOKTOR_AD_SOYAD, RANDEVU.RANDEVU_SAATI
FROM RANDEVU
WHERE (((RANDEVU.RANDEVU_TARIHI) Between [Forms]![TARİH]![baslangic_tarih] And [Forms]![TARİH]![bitis_tarih]));

sorgu isimli butonun tıkalndığındaki olayı aşğıdaki gibi değiştirin.
Me.tarih_sorgula.Requery
Toprağa her türlü kötü şey atılmasına rağmen
Topraktan hep güzel şeyler biter . (Akşemseddin)
Cevapla
Çözüldü #4
SELECT RANDEVU.RANDEVU_SIRASI, RANDEVU.HASTA_AD_SOYAD, RANDEVU.RANDEVU_TARIHI, RANDEVU.DOKTOR_AD_SOYAD, RANDEVU.RANDEVU_SAATI
FROM RANDEVU
WHERE (((RANDEVU.RANDEVU_TARIHI) Between [Forms]![TARİH]![baslangic_tarih] And [Forms]![TARİH]![bitis_tarih]));

satır kaynağına girdim ama tabloda cıkmadı veriler ama whereden sonraki kısmı silince bütün veriler cıktı sonrada butona olay yordamına tıklandığındaki
Me.tarih_sorgula.Requery
kodu yazdım ama tarih sectiğimzde arama yapmadı ismail bey Img-cray
Cevapla
Çözüldü #5
ilk tarih ve son tarih alanlarına veri girdiniz mi?

YENİ RANDEVU TAKİP.rar
Toprağa her türlü kötü şey atılmasına rağmen
Topraktan hep güzel şeyler biter . (Akşemseddin)
Cevapla
Çözüldü #6
hayır girmedim o kısma hangi kodu nereye yazıcaz ismail abi
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da
Task